Literature Review
The concerns about
the effects of immigrants on the host
economy have
1980s have been a period of particularly active investigation of
a long history but the
this question in the
U.S.
We will
not attempt to survey this literature in an exhaustive fashion here but rather concentrate on
outlining the major empirical strategies that have been followed
and criticisms
that
have been
raised.
1
Three basic approaches have been taken
to assess the
labor market effects of immigration.
One
is to
in a
system of labor demand equations with multiple labor inputs
recognize that immigrant labor
is
often less skilled and estimate substitution elasticities
(e.g.
Grossman, 1982). This
approach has not been used for Germany because wage data are not available separately for
natives and immigrants.

persistent over time then previous immigrants could have been locating in labor markets that

Butcher, Kristin F. and David Card (1991) "Immigration and wages: Evidence from the 1980s."
American Economic Review Papers and Proceedings
81,
Card, David (1990) "The impact of the Mariel Boatlift on the
292-296
